> How can I grab the value of @href as each question is evaluated? Matthew, To determine URL of the file, where the current node is located, you can use generate-id() function. The root node for your current node must have the same id generated by generate-id() function as the one generated for one of the root nodes of the documents compiled together via document() function. Therefore, you need to define a variable for the root node of the current node: <xsl:variable name="doc" select="generate-id(/)" /> and get the URL by: <xsl:value-of select="$all-questions//quiz[generate-id(document(@href)) = $doc]/@href" /> Also, I suggest that you avoid using // operator if you know the path to quiz elements beforehand - for example, selecting "$all-questions/myquiz/quiz" is faster than "$all-questions//quiz" if $all-questions contains other children than myquiz.
